Navigate to Edit Preferences Win or Acrobat Preferences Mac then select Signatures Identities Trusted Certificates More Click on Digital ID Files select the one you want to detach and click Detach File After that you can delete the pfx file. Users of shared machines (including labs and classrooms) will be prompted to confirm that they are still using the software every 90 minutes this is an Adobe setting, not one that is available to change at this time. Only users with Enterprise accounts can access the Adobe software on campus.įor single-user computers, the activation will persist through restarts of the computer and you will remain signed in on that computer until you specifically choose to sign out (or change your password). If you have created your own Adobe account using your E-town email address, you will be prompted to choose between an Adobe ID and an Enterprise ID: choose the Enterprise ID option to be redirected to the Elizabethtown College login page.
